Proof Point
FAA System Security
We conduct formal NIST SP 800-53 Rev 5 security control assessments annually for FAA systems, producing SAPs, SARs, risk analysis reports, and executive summaries. We advised regarding the migration from NIST 800-53 Rev 4 to Rev 5 for multiple FAA systems and provided control tailoring and implementation statements. Finally, we provided Zero Trust architecture planning and gap analysis aligned with NIST maturity model at FAA.

What is a virtual CIO (vCIO)?
An experienced CIO who sets and runs your IT strategy part-time or by project, instead of as a full-time hire. You get senior technology leadership for the decisions that need it, sized to what you actually need.
What is a virtual or fractional CISO (vCISO)?
A senior security leader who owns your risk and compliance strategy without a full-time salary. A vCISO provides information security services to an organization on a part-time, outsourced, or contract basis. Our vCISO advisors set your security direction, map your obligations, and lead the plan to meet them. What is a virtual CTO?
An experienced CTO who owns your technical direction: architecture, build-versus-buy, modernization, and the roadmap, on the schedule your organization needs.
When do I need fractional executive leadership?
When the stakes are high but the need isn't full-time: a modernization, an audit or breach, a regulation you now fall under, a board that wants a technology strategy, or a gap between permanent leaders.
What is IT strategy consulting?
Setting the direction for your technology: where you are today, where you need to be, and the roadmap between them, tied to your mission, budget, and compliance obligations.
